BATH

Fans of the timeless music of The Moody Blues will not want to miss the cover band Sojourn perform at 7:30 p.m. tonight at the Chocolate Church Arts Center. The musicians of Sojourn, who span two decades in age, will recreate classic sounds from “Nights In White Satin” to “Your Wildest Dreams” during their show.

Sojourn entertains audiences with The Moody Blues music that is so unique and instantly identifiable.

“We have all loved this music since we first heard it, in whatever decade that might have been,” keyboardist Mark McNeil explaind. “Much to our delight, we found that there is a tremendous demand out there to hear it… but unlike other popular bands such as the Beatles, who boast many cover bands in every region, no one in this part of the country is doing what we are, playing Moody Blues music exclusively, and with a very authentic sound.”

Sojourn is made up of Chris Doehne of Yarmouth, Jerry Perron of Brunswick, Parker Kenyon of Harpswell, Lee Robinson of Warren and Mark McNeil of West Bath.

SOJOURN will perform at the Chocolate Church Arts Center, located at 804 Washington Street in Bath tonight only. Tickets are $10 advance and $14 door and are available online at chocolatechurcharts.org or by calling the box office 442-8455.
